The A/C fan (blower) on my 1990 CRX only works now on positions 3 and 4. It used to work on 1-4, then 1 dropped out, and then 2 dropped out. Any suggestions? Perhaps the blower resistor? the blower itself, or both?

Re: A/C blower only works on 3 and 4 setting
Yep, it's the resistor. It's located behind the glove box and is attached to the fan housing. Once you take it out it's easy to see if the coils are broken or not. The dealer sells them but you can save money and get a few at the junk yard. I think 5th gen civics use the same part as well. GL
